TDP alleges former APPSC chairman Gautam Sawang’s role in Group I exam irregularities

Vijayawada: Following the latest revelations in the probe on alleged irregularities in Group-1 evaluation and recruitment, the ruling TDP targeted Gautam Sawang, the then chairman of Andhra Pradesh Public Service Commission (APPSC). The biodiversity board chairman and official spokesperson of TDP, Neelayapalem Vijay Kumar, said that Sawang was equally involved as PSR Anjaneyulu, the then secretary of APPSC. He said that Sawang prematurely resigned from the constitutional post and fled as he knew about the repercussions of his wrongdoings.Vijay Kumarstated that Gautam Sawang ruined the careers of many APPSC candidates by blatantly lying to the High Court by submitting false details about re-evaluation. Being in a constitutional position, Sawang misled constitutional posts to appease his political masters at Tadepalli, said Vijay Kumar.In 2018, during the TDP regime, a notification was released for APPSC, and the subsequent YSRCP govt conducted the exams.Several petitions were filed before the High Court, contending mistakes in the question papers and also challenging computer evaluation instead of manual evaluation as mentioned in the notification. The High Court set aside the computer evaluation and directed a manual evaluation. However, the results between computer evaluation and manual evaluation showed a huge difference, which prompted many candidates to approach the High Court again.The manual evaluation was done again following the directions of the High Court, but in the process, there were allegations that the evaluation was done twice and the results of the second evaluation were withheld. The final lists were prepared by cherry-picking candidates favourable to the ruling dispensation. The probe initiated after the NDA govt came to power found various irregularities in the evaluation process. The Camsign company, which was given the contract for evaluation, hired ineligible people, including auto drivers, to evaluate Group-1 answer papers.Vijay Kumar said that it is evident that Sawang was equally involved in the scam and he should be held responsible along with Anjaneyulu and Camsign. Vijay Kumar wondered why the members of APPSC, who are also in constitutional positions, kept silent without raising objections to the corrupt practices of the Chairman and Secretary. He demanded the investigation agency probe and unearth the involvement of Sawang in the APPSC scam.
